A 70-year-old man with melanoma on his leg has a sentinel lymph node biopsy that is positive. Immunohistochemistry of the sentinel node shows melanoma cells positive for S100 protein, Melan-A, and HMB-45. Which of these markers is most sensitive for melanoma?

Correct answer: ES100 protein

S100 protein is the correct answer. It is the classic most sensitive immunohistochemical marker for melanoma because it is expressed in the great majority of melanocytic tumours, including variants such as spindle cell/desmoplastic melanoma that may be negative for Melan-A and HMB-45. Its limitation is poor specificity, so it is interpreted with more specific melanocytic markers. Melan-A/MART-1 and HMB-45 are more specific markers of melanocytic differentiation but are less sensitive, especially in desmoplastic/spindle cell melanoma. SOX10 is also a highly useful nuclear melanocytic marker in modern practice, but for this SBA the tested principle is that S100 protein is the most sensitive melanoma marker. CK20 is an epithelial marker classically associated with Merkel cell carcinoma and gastrointestinal/urothelial tumours, not melanoma.
